Я пытался занести в черный список мой драйвер AMD Radeon с открытым исходным кодом, чтобы моя система использовала только графику Intel HD 4000 Ivy Bridge. Какова правильная процедура? Я использую xserver-xorg-video-ati
, в настоящее время.
В настройках BIOS моего компьютера HP Envy 15t-3200, к сожалению, не отображаются параметры конфигурации для отключения дискретной видеокарты, поэтому я ищу способ сделать это в ОС.
vgaswitcheroo
применяется, если имеется свободный драйвер от ядра Linux и активирована настройка режима ядра. Так что должно работать, если не установлен fgrlx. Я сделал так, чтобы мой Sony VPCSA с аналогичной настройкой (Intel 4000, Radeon 6600M) работал.
Я заменил строку в /etc/defalut/grub
(1):
GRUB_CMDLINE_LINUX="video.allow_duplicates=1 radeon.modeset=1"
Это исправило проблему для Ubuntu 12.10. Однако этого недостаточно для Debian / unstable. Кроме того, мне пришлось добавить строку в /etc/modprobe.d/blacklist.conf
(2):
blacklist radeon
И в /etc/rc.local
ДО exit 0;
(3):
modprobe radeon modeset=1
mount -t debugfs none /sys/kernel/debug/
echo OFF > /sys/kernel/debug/vgaswitcheroo/switch
Если вы есть проблемы, начните с (2). Это надежно привело к загрузочной системе, чем перейти к (3).
Я думаю, что эта проблема также не была решена в других операционных системах (Windows) - так что, похоже, это проблема аппаратного обеспечения, а не программного обеспечения.
Upd: вот дополнительная информация http://h30434.www3.hp.com/t5/Notebook-Display-and-Video-eg-Windows-8/HP-Envy-17-3D-CTO -3200-HD-4000-graphics-WiDi-заблокировано-вне / td-p / 1630785
и http://reviews.cnet.com/laptops/hp-envy -17t-3200 / 4864-3121_7-35328488.html